Voyager Free 60+ Charge Case

Voyager Free 60+ 

Scenario:

Charge case has limited charge, ear buds in case are fully charged.

While using the earbuds for long, say battary reduced to 40%.
The earbuds begin charging, but the case shuts down before they’re fully charged

 

Next : When the earbuds are removed, the charging case is completely drained. Even if the earbuds themselves still hold around 80% charge, they won’t connect to the PC because the case is fully discharged. As a result, the last charging cycle of the earbuds becomes unusable.

 

Imprvement : leave 5% battry in case so buds can connect and work.
